This is a minimally invasive procedure known as bronchoscopy, where a small camera is passed into your airways under sedation. This technique is used to evaluate undiagnosed mediastinal lesions, including lymph nodes and masses. In some cases, EBUS (Endobronchial Ultrasound) is used for a more detailed assessment, while rigid bronchoscopy and thoracoscopy may also be considered depending on the specific clinical scenario.
